In a significant move to enhance safety within the Australian agricultural sector, WFI Insurance has announced a partnership with Farmsafe Australia.
This collaboration is designed to raise awareness about farming hazards and advocate for the adoption of safer work practices among farmers.

Farmsafe Australia is dedicated to improving the wellbeing and productivity of Australian agriculture by providing resources that help farmers implement proactive safety measures and make informed decisions. Through this partnership, WFI Insurance will assume the role of ambassador for Farmsafe Australia and sponsor the annual 'Safer Farms Report,' scheduled for release during National Farm Safety Week from July 14 to July 20, 2024.

Andrew Beer, Executive General Manager at WFI, expressed enthusiasm about the partnership, stating, 'WFI Insurance is delighted to be partnering with Farmsafe Australia. In line with our purpose 'to make your world a safer place,' we have a shared ambition to protect the safety and wellbeing of farmers and their farms.' He emphasized the importance of education and raising risk awareness to prevent accidents and injuries on farms.

Felicity Richards, Chairperson of Farmsafe Australia, highlighted the shared goals of both organizations in their concerted effort to decrease the incidence of accidents, injuries, and fatalities on farms. 'Farmers work in the elements, with large animals, chemicals, machinery, and heavy loads. Their work can be remote and solitary, with farmers often unaware of the significant risks they are exposed to. Together, WFI Insurance and Farmsafe can help farmers mitigate those risks and return home safely every day,' she said.

This partnership is particularly timely, given the recent statistics indicating a rise in farm-related incidents. The 2025 Safer Farms Report revealed that the past year was particularly challenging for Australian agriculture, with 72 farm-related deaths-the highest figure recorded in over 20 years. Additionally, claims involving impact injuries, such as those caused by vehicles or crush incidents, increased by 44%, marking the highest level of such claims in four years.

By combining WFI Insurance's extensive experience in rural insurance with Farmsafe Australia's commitment to safety education, this partnership aims to provide farmers with the tools and knowledge necessary to create safer working environments. The collaboration underscores the critical importance of proactive safety measures in reducing the risk of accidents and ensuring the wellbeing of those working in the agricultural sector.

The Australian insurance industry is preparing for a downturn in profitability after achieving a decade-high return on equity (ROE) of 19% in the 2024-25 financial year. This peak performance was driven by robust underwriting results, substantial investment returns, and a period of relatively low natural disaster claims. However, industry analysts predict a six-point decline in ROE to 13% for the current financial year, bringing it back within the typical target range of 10% to 15%. - read more

The Australian insurtech sector is demonstrating remarkable resilience and adaptability, with many startups reporting significant growth and successful market expansion. A recent survey of Insurtech Australia members reveals that companies generating annual revenues between $1 million and $10 million have experienced a 30% increase in revenue. Additionally, there has been a 10% rise in investment from private backers, indicating strong confidence in the sector's potential. - read more

Argis Underwriting has announced a new partnership with Newcastle-based Pacific International Insurance, enabling the company to resume offering farm insurance coverage across Australia. This development comes after Argis ceased providing new business and renewal terms on its Farm Extra Insurance in April, following the conclusion of a five-year arrangement with HDI Global Specialty. - read more
